Aixro XR-50
|
Germany
|
The
Aixro XR-50 is a 4 stroke rotary valve engine. It is designed to be
a low maintenance, low cost but high performance engine. |

Animal
|
USA
|
The
Animal motor is a 4 cycle Briggs and Stratton Engine. It is a low
cost great entry level class. It is used widely in both Sprint and
Enduro. The Animal motor is run stock and modified. Check the governing
organization for rules. |

Comer

|
Italy
|
Comer
has a complete line of 2 stroke motors from kid kart to TaG. The most
popular are the C-50 (soon to be C-51) which is the motor ran in the
U.S. for the kid kart (ages 5-7)class. The other popular application
of the Comer motor is the Cadet class. Nationally the Comer engine
is usually the engine of choice. |

HPV
(IAME) 
|
Italy
|
The
HPV engine, manufactured by IAME. Is a 2 stroke, 100cc engine. It
has a dry centrifugal clutch. It is run in North America for Jr. Sportsman
to Adults. The Jr. Sportsman will run a 2 pipe, Junior to Senior will
have a 3 pipe, and in some areas a 4 pipe is run for Seniors. |

Rotax
SEE
RM1 Package
|
Austria
|
The
Rotax Kart Engine is a 2 cycle TaG motor usually ran under the RMax
Challenge rules in the U.S. It is an option for competition in the
TaG class in some series. It is a sealed motor. Available packages
for ages 7 to adult. (with minor modifications.) |

Vampire

|
Switzerland
|
The
Vampire is on the cutting edge of the future of karting. It is fuel
injected which makes it better on gas and opens the option for alternative
fuel sources down the line. It is raced in the U.S. under the TaG
4 stroke classification. A 250cc motor with little maintenance. Junior
and Senior packages available. |

WTP

(John Mills Engineer Ltd. is a distributor of the WTP engine. A
WTP manufacturer site has not been found)
|
Italy
|
The
WTP motor is a 60cc TaG engine used world wide as a "cadet"
class motor for the 7-11 age range. (8-12) in some series. In the
U.K. they have a WTP Championship series. In the U.S.A. it is an approved
TaG USA motor for the the Cadet I and Cadet II class. |

Yamaha
KT100
|
Japan
|
The
KT100 is a high performance, versatile engine choice for 2 cycle karting.
Classes can be found in most local, district and national series for
drivers from age 8 to adult. For the heavier driver many times a light,
medium and heavy class can be found. Stand alone events such as street
races and temporary courses generally have some type of yamaha kt100
class. The KT100 is also an option for junior drivers in the autocross/solo
racing. |
